Pokemon Pearl Review

Rating: 8 Out of 10

Pokemon Diamond and Pearl are the first Pokemon games to be released for the Nintendo DS and they still stick with that formula that you have come to know in the previous games. This game has a colorful presentation mixing 2D with 3D, an enthusiastic soundtrack, the introduction of online play, over 100 new Pokemon, and an engaging single player story. However, the touch screen controls are underwhelming, the sounds are somewhat recycled from previous games, and there is some accessibility issues with the online. Overall though, if you liked Pokemon in the past then you should like this one just the same.
